Are Forex Trading Apps in South Africa Safe?


When considering the best forex trading apps in South Africa, the safety and security of these platforms is a paramount concern for traders. It is essential to ensure that the apps adhere to strict regulations and offer robust security features to protect users' financial information. The regulatory environment in South Africa is primarily overseen by the Financial Sector Conduct Authority (FSCA), which plays a critical role in ensuring that brokers operate transparently and fairly. Forex trading apps that are regulated by the FSCA are required to meet specific compliance standards, thereby enhancing their credibility and trustworthiness.


To assess the safety of forex trading apps in South Africa, traders should look for certain security features. Reputable trading platforms typically employ advanced encryption protocols to safeguard users’ data during transactions. A strong encryption standard, such as SSL (Secure Socket Layer), should be in place, ensuring that sensitive information is transmitted securely over the internet. Additionally, traders should verify that the app implements account protection measures, such as two-factor authentication (2FA), which provides an extra layer of security against unauthorized access.


Another critical aspect of safety in forex trading apps is the use of regulated brokers. When choosing a platform, it is imperative to check whether the broker is registered with the FSCA or other recognized regulatory bodies. This registration not only provides assurance that the broker is operating legally, but it also offers support and recourse in case of disputes. Before using a forex trading app, traders should conduct thorough research and consider community feedback, user reviews, and the app's track record to ensure they are selecting a safe and reliable option.


In conclusion, while there are risks associated with forex trading, choosing an app that prioritizes security and regulatory compliance can significantly mitigate these concerns and enhance trading experiences in South Africa.
